What is special education tutoring?

Special education tutoring provides individualized instruction for students with learning differences such as dyslexia, ADHD, autism, and other conditions. Our certified specialists use evidence-based methods tailored to each student's unique needs.

How do I know if my child needs SPED services?

Signs include difficulty with reading, writing, or math despite effort; trouble focusing or staying organized; challenges with social skills; or significant gaps compared to peers. We offer assessments to help identify specific learning needs.

What does twice-exceptional (2e) mean?

Twice-exceptional students are gifted and also have a learning disability, ADHD, or other challenge. They need both enrichment for their strengths and support for their areas of difficulty — a balance that standard programs often miss.
